logo

Output d6bde6160daedd76e647b4654b1c38046617495837708a38f69c2c323390abba:0

value
270803162
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21b964ee237bdafda91fe6dca9453dddbfecee42 OP_EQUALVERIFY OP_CHECKSIG
address
145KPkTjM5QaVCBjqC6kHMek8CKjqpkYZc
transaction
d6bde6160daedd76e647b4654b1c38046617495837708a38f69c2c323390abba